std::stacktrace_entry:: description
|
|
|||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
| Member functions | ||||
| Observers | ||||
| Query | ||||
|
stacktrace_entry::description
|
||||
| Non-member functions | ||||
| Helper classes | ||||
|
std::
string
описание
(
)
const
;
|
(начиная с C++23) | |
Возвращает описание вычисления, представленного * this при успешном выполнении, или пустую строку при неудаче, кроме случаев сбоя выделения памяти, например, когда * this является пустым.
Содержание |
Параметры
(нет)
Возвращаемое значение
Описание представленной оценки при успешном выполнении, пустая строка при неудаче, кроме случаев сбоя выделения памяти.
Исключения
Выбрасывает std::bad_alloc если память для внутренних структур данных или результирующей строки не может быть выделена.
Примечания
Поддержка пользовательских аллокаторов для этой функции не предоставляется, поскольку реализации обычно требуют платформо-специфичных аллокаций, системных вызовов и большого объема ресурсоемкой работы, в то время как пользовательский аллокатор не предоставляет преимуществ для этой функции, так как платформо-специфичные операции занимают на порядок больше времени, чем аллокация.
Пример
|
Этот раздел не завершён
Причина: отсутствует пример |